Zuned Fabric Tensor Model of Gravity Version 2
Authors/Creators
Description
This research paper presents "The Zuned Model," a novel theoretical framework in physics that addresses the limitations of General Relativity, specifically singularities and the requirements for Dark Matter and Dark Energy. By introducing a "Simple Fabric Logic," the model proposes that space acts as an elastic fabric with a specific Mechanical Limit (\Delta t_0 \approx 1.05s) and mass-dependent stiffness (\rho_K).
Key Highlights of the Model:
Black Hole Singularity Resolution: Predicts a finite core radius (r_{core}), preventing infinite density and time-collapse.
Galaxy Rotation Curves: Explains the flat rotation curves of galaxies without the need for Dark Matter by accounting for fabric tension.
Cosmic Acceleration: Provides a mechanism for the expansion of the universe through a scalar field (\phi) representation, acting as a dynamical alternative to the Cosmological Constant.
Gravitational Wave Echoes: Predicts specific echo time delays (\Delta t_{echo}) for supermassive black holes, offering a testable signature for LIGO/Virgo observations.
